Items Typically Excluded or By Special Arrangement

To keep everyone safe and comply with insurance, some items are excluded or require prior agreement:

  • Hazardous materials (fuel, gas cylinders, chemicals, paint, solvents)
  • Illegal or stolen goods
  • Heavy industrial machinery or items exceeding safe lifting limits
  • Large pianos, safes or specialist equipment without prior notice
  • Live animals or perishable foods
  • High-value collections (art, antiques) unless agreed and properly packed

If you are unsure about a particular item, mention it during your enquiry and we will advise on what is possible and how it can be moved safely.

Our Step-by-Step Furniture Removals Process

1. Enquiry & Quote

Contact us by phone or online with your dates, addresses and a list of furniture to be moved. We will ask a few practical questions about access, parking and any awkward items. Based on this, we provide a clear, no-obligation quote outlining what is included so you know exactly what to expect.

2. Survey (Virtual or Onsite)

For larger moves or properties with restricted access, we arrange a virtual or onsite survey. This lets us assess staircases, lifts, doorways and parking, and confirm the size of vehicle and number of movers required. Surveys help prevent delays on the day and ensure we bring the right protection materials and tools.

3. Packing & Preparation

You can pack smaller items yourself, or choose our professional packing service. For furniture, we protect:

  • Mattresses and soft furnishings with covers where requested
  • Tables, units and wardrobes with padded blankets and wraps
  • Delicate surfaces and glass with additional protection

We can also dismantle standard beds, wardrobes and similar items when agreed in advance, and secure fixings so nothing is misplaced.

4. Loading & Transport

On moving day, our trained, uniformed team arrives on time and walks through the plan with you. We load the vehicle systematically, using straps, blankets and floor protection where needed. Furniture is secured to prevent movement in transit. Your goods are covered by our goods in transit insurance, and all vehicles are maintained to a high standard for reliable transport across Scotland and beyond.

5. Unloading & Placement

At your new property, we unload items into the rooms you specify. We place larger pieces where you want them and reassemble any furniture we took apart by prior agreement. Before leaving, we check that everything has been delivered and positioned as requested and invite you to walk round and confirm you are satisfied.

Frequently Asked Questions

How much do furniture removals in Scotland cost?

The cost depends mainly on the volume and type of furniture, the distance between addresses and how straightforward the access is at each property. Smaller local moves may be priced on an hourly rate, while larger moves are usually quoted as a fixed price. Optional services such as packing, dismantling and reassembly, or out-of-hours work will affect the total. Once we have your details and, if needed, carried out a survey, we provide a clear written quote so you know the full cost before you book.

Can you do same-day or urgent furniture removals?

We can often accommodate short-notice or urgent moves, especially outside peak times, but it will always depend on our schedule and the scale of the job. For a few items or a small flat, same-day may be possible if a team and vehicle are available. Larger house or office moves usually need at least some planning. If you need an urgent move, call us as soon as you know your dates and we will confirm what we can realistically do, along with accurate pricing.

What insurance cover is included?

Your furniture is covered by our goods in transit insurance while it is being moved in our vehicles, subject to policy terms and any declared value limits. We also hold public liability insurance to cover accidental damage to buildings or third-party property during the move. Insurance is not a substitute for good handling, so we focus on prevention first, but it provides an important safety net. We are happy to share policy details on request so you can see exactly what is covered and ensure it meets your needs.

What is included in your furniture removals service as standard?

As standard, we provide a vehicle of the right size, a trained removals team, protective blankets and securing straps, loading and unloading of furniture, and placement of items into the rooms you specify. We protect your goods in transit under our insurance and offer basic dismantling of agreed items where this has been arranged in advance. Optional extras include full or part packing, supply of packing materials, storage and out-of-hours working. Your written quote will make clear exactly what is and is not included for your particular move.

How is a professional removals service different from a man-and-van?

A casual man-and-van may simply provide transport and basic lifting, often without formal training, insurance or clear terms. A professional removals service like ours offers trained staff, fully insured vehicles, proper protective materials, planned timings and written documentation. We assess access, bring the right equipment and manage the whole process from start to finish. This reduces the risk of damage, delays and unexpected costs. For valuable furniture or larger moves, the extra protection and reliability usually far outweigh any small difference in headline price.

How far in advance should I book my furniture removal?

For planned house or office moves, we recommend booking as soon as you have a likely date – ideally two to four weeks in advance, and longer for peak periods such as Fridays and month-ends. That said, we understand dates can change, especially with property purchases, so we try to be flexible where possible. For smaller or local jobs, a few days’ notice may be enough if we have availability. The earlier you contact us, the easier it is to secure your preferred date and time.
